Enkh-Orgil ‘The Tormentor’ Baatarkhuu is at the peak of his powers, following a historic world title victory over Fabricio ‘Wonder Boy’ Andrade earlier this month.
The newly crowned ONE bantamweight MMA world champion outlasted the Brazilian star in the main event of ONE Fight Night 38: Andrade vs. Baatarkhuu on Prime Video, submitting ‘Wonder Boy’ with a rear-naked choke in the fourth round.
Afterward, Baatarkhuu thanked his fans for all the support and said he appreciates the recognition.
‘The Tormentor’ told Bangkok Post’s Nick Atkin:

“There has been a lot of love from people. And my life has changed, you know. I have been training for over 25 years. So, you know, with that hard work, I became a champion, and I absolutely love people noticing me and praising me, saying that they love me. You know, they have also been giving me a lot of gifts and all. It’s obviously great.”

Baatarkhuu, who is also a finalist on Netflix hit reality competition series Physical: Asia, came home to Mongolia to a hero’s welcome, even honored by the country’s President for his momentous achievement.

Enkh-Orgil Baatarkhuu credits fallen adversary Fabricio Andrade’s toughness
Enkh-Orgil Baatarkhuu scored the biggest win of his career with a fourth-round submission of former bantamweight MMA king Fabricio ‘Wonder Boy’ Andrade at ONE Fight Night 38: Andrade vs. Baatarkhuu on Prime Video.
After their grueling main event fight, ‘The Tormentor’ couldn’t help but give credit to the Brazilian superstar for his incredible toughness throughout their fight.
The Mongolian star said in the ring:
“There’s no word for me to explain how I feel now. It’s incredible. Fabricio, you are so good. I’m so tired now.”
